Capacity note for the Fennelgrid sidecar review. Aggregation window widened to cut emit rate; per-pod memory ceiling holds at current cardinality (~12k series). CPU flat. Risk: buffer overflow if a tenant spikes labels — mitigated by the drop policy. No node-pool changes needed for the Caldermoor cluster this quarter. Review the flush and buffer settings before merge. Constants under review are below.

limits module of yafop-hahag:
QUOTAS = {
    "tamwyn": 652,
    "prawyn": 731,
}

**Changed defaults: export retry behavior**

Failed exports are now retried automatically. Previously, a failed export required manual re-submission, which caused backlogs during the Brinmoor outage. The new defaults retry up to three times with exponential backoff, and retries are skipped for validation errors since those never succeed on repeat. Operators can still disable retries per destination. No migration is required; existing jobs pick up the new behavior on restart. The shipped defaults are listed below.

deployment values, kajep-kageg:
[praix]
host = praix.paliqcorp.corp
user = praix_svc
database = praix_prod

14:22 — Queue depth on the Fenwick ingest tier crossed 40k. Autoscaler held at floor because the new plugin-supplied cost metric reported zero, masking load. 14:31 — Manual scale-up to 12 workers; backlog drained by 14:58. Root cause: third-party metric adapters may return zero instead of null on collection failure; the autoscaler treats zero as idle. Fix: treat stale or zero metrics as unknown and fall back to native depth. Plugin authors should retest adapters against the patched build noted below.

trace token, fafog-kageg: htk4_98e6

Internal Memo — Loyalty Programme Overhaul

Department heads: the Bramblepoint Rewards scheme will be restructured next quarter. Points accrual moves to spend-based tiers; dormant accounts over two years will be sunset with notice. Customer communications are being drafted by the Marlow team. Please assess operational impacts in your areas. The commercial objectives driving this change are outlined in the confidential note below.

management briefing: Project Ulavan slips by two quarters because of the staffing delay.